How to Make Cheesy Hamburger Broccoli Skillet
Ingredients
- 1 pound ground beef
- 2 cups broccoli florets (fresh or frozen)
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 medium onion (diced)
- 2 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1/2 cup beef broth
- 1 cup cooked rice (optional)
Directions
- In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
- Add the diced onion and sauté for about 3-4 minutes until it is translucent.
- Add the minced garlic and ground beef to the skillet. Cook until the beef is browned, breaking it apart with a spatula, for about 5-7 minutes.
- Drain any excess fat if necessary.
- Stir in the salt, black pepper, and paprika. Mix well to combine.
- Add the broccoli florets and beef broth to the skillet. Cover and cook for about 5-7 minutes, or until the broccoli is tender.
- If using, stir in the cooked rice until well combined.
-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ese over the top, cover, and let it c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until the cheese is melted.
- Serve warm and enjoy!

How to Store Cheesy Hamburger Broccoli Skillet
To store leftovers, let the skillet cool completely. Trans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ate. It should last for about 3-4 days in the fridge. You can reheat it on the stove or in the microwave.

Variation
You can make this recipe vegetarian by using plant-based ground beef alternatives and vegetable broth instead of beef broth. You can also skip the cheese or use a dairy-free cheese option.

Q: Can I freeze the leftovers?
A: Yes, you can freeze the skillet meal in an airtight container for up to 2-3 months. Just thaw in the fridge before reheating.
